I was banded in Mexico by Dr. Zapata in fall of 2010. It was a great experience there and I would recommend him to anyone. I got off to a good start with minimal problems and lost 75 lbs. over about a year time. I was disappointed when the weight loss began to slowly decline and then stopped all together. I was more active than ever, eating habits didn't change, nothing different....just didn't lose weight. Waited 6 months or so and had another fill, still no change. Then after about a year my weight began to climb again and now I'm back up 30 lbs!

My regular Dr. can find nothing out of the ordinary after several exams and many blood tests. I'm exhausted all the time and personally think that I'm beginning to have some blood sugar issues when I don't eat properly or exercise...get weak and shaky.

I'm disgusted, confused, depressed over all of this especially since I paid out of pocket for my surgery, no insurance since I had no existing health issues!

I don't feel I need another fill since I feel restriction and have to eat VERY slowly and get full quickly. I eat high Protein, low/no carbs. I don't know what to do....so upset about this!

Thanks for letting me vent!!! :)

I agree that after years our body seems to adjust to a new set point. I am faithful to good food, high protein and working out. Not perfect but really good 90+% of the time. Yet my body wants to stay within a 5 lb range. I don't gain so I'm good with it. Just seems like eating close to 1000 calories or under would stimulate more weight loss...... but sadly not the case I do love staying a smaller size for years tho!
